摘 要:从全世界疫情报告来看,2019新型冠状病毒肺炎(新冠肺炎)重症患者病死率高.糖尿病患者是新冠肺炎的易感人群,合并糖尿病的新冠肺炎患者病死率较高,所以认为高血糖是重症新冠肺炎的独立危险因素,针对感染新型冠状病毒(2019-nCoV)的重症患者目前也无确切有效的治疗方法.临床研究中观察到重症新冠肺炎患者体内出现"细胞因子风暴",持续高水平的细胞因子造成肺毛细血管内皮细胞及肺泡上皮细胞的弥漫性损伤,引起急性呼吸窘迫综合征(ARDS).ARDS是导致新冠肺炎患者死亡的主要原因.宿主导向疗法(HDT)是抗感染领域中的新兴治疗方法,可以激活人体自身保护性免疫反应,抑制过强的炎症反应,用于辅助传统药物治疗以缩短患者病程.二甲双胍被证实有宿主导向疗效,可以辅助治疗病毒和细菌感染性疾病.本文对二甲双胍辅助治疗重症新冠肺炎的合理性及潜在机制进行讨论,推测对重症新冠肺炎合并糖尿病患者使用二甲双胍进行降糖治疗,有可能预防或抑制ARDS发生,从而降低患者病死率,其作用机制可能是通过抑制白细胞介素-6(IL-6)信号通路,阻断"细胞因子风暴",延缓肺纤维化进程,抑制内吞作用,从而上调血管紧张素转换酶2(ACE2)表达.According to the world epidemic report,the mortality of patients with severe coronavirus disease 2019(COVID-19)is high.Diabetic patients are more susceptible to COVID-19.Since the mortality of COVID-19 patients with diabetes is on the top of list,hyperglycemia is considered an independent risk factor for severe COVID-19.Up to now,there is few effective treatment for severe patients infected with 2019 novel coronavirus(2019-nCoV).Clinical studies observed that cytokine storms existed in patients with severe COVID-19.Sustained high levels of cytokines cause diffuse damage to pulmonary capillary endothelial cells and alveolar epithelial cells,resulting in acute respiratory distress syndrome(ARDS).ARDS is the main cause of death in COVID-19 patients.Host-directed therapy(HDT)is an emerging therapeutic method in the field of anti-infection,which can activate the self-protective immune response,suppress excessive inflammatory response,and be used to assist the treatment of traditional drugs to shorten the course of disease.Metformin has been shown to be effective in HDT and can assist in the treatment of the viral and bacterial infectious disease.This paper discusses the rationality and potential therapeutic mechanism of metformin in the treatment of severe COVID-19.It was speculated that the use of metformin for controlling blood glucose in severe COVID-19 patients with diabetes may prevent or inhibit the occurrence of ARDS,thereby reducing the mortality of COVID-19 patients.The possible mechanism is that metformin could inhibit cytokine storm via suppressing interleukin-6(IL-6)signaling,prevent the process of lung fibrosis,suppress endocytosis,thereby elevating angiotensin converting enzyme 2(ACE2)expression.
